以TokenPocket(TP)冷钱包为例:从部署到管控的全面实操与风险评估

导言:本文以TokenPocket(以下简称TP)冷钱包场景为参照,结合通用冷钱包安全原则,分主题深入分析:安全巡检、合约验证、专家观点报告、创新科技前景、公钥管理与自动化管理的可行方案与落地要点。文中既包含操作层面的建议,也给出治理与监控层的方案,便于项目方或个人搭建并长期维护高可信度的冷钱包体系。

一、冷钱包部署与基础流程

- 环境准备:选择可信硬件或离线设备(专用笔记本或微控制器),断网、格式化并安装最小化系统;准备打印版或刻录版的种子备份方案(BIP39助记词/冷存储卡)。

- 生成密钥:在离线设备上生成助记词与私钥,记录对应的公钥(xpub/公钥导出),并尽量使用分层确定性钱包(HD)以便后续地址管理。

- 签名流程:使用离线签名并通过QR码或扫图像传输签名到联机设备,避免私钥触网。

- 多重备份:采用3-2或5-3的备份策略(碎片化备份,异地保存),并对备份介质加密与签名以防篡改。

二、安全巡检(Checklist 与落地方案)

- 物理安全:检查存放地点(防火、防水、防窃),验证硬件完整性(防拆封标签、硬件指纹)。

- 软件完整性:校验固件/离线系统签名、比较哈希值;定期检查是否存在未授权固件更新。

- 密钥与助记词检查:确认助记词生成过程无外部通信,检查备份介质防篡改,定期进行恢复演练(恢复到隔离设备并验证地址一致)。

- 访问控制:制定私钥访问策略(谁能触碰、在何种条件下使用),建立审批与多签门槛流程。

- 日志与审计:记录每次签名、备份访问与硬件维护操作的审计条目并安全存档。

- 漏洞响应:保持应急联络清单,制定私钥疑泄露的应急流程(立即冻结关联热钱包、通知合作方、转移资产)。

三、合约验证(对接合约或托管资产前的必要步骤)

- 地址来源确认:核验合约地址与官方公告、代码库、交易平台公开信息的一致性,防止钓鱼替换。

- 源码对比:如果合约公开,核对链上bytecode与Github源码编译输出是否一致;使用工具(Etherscan、Polygonscan等)进行字节码到源码的一致性验证。

- 权限审计:检查合约是否含有管理员函数(mint、proxy、transferFrom、pausable、owner),评估是否存在提权、紧急回收或锁定用户资产的风险。

- 依赖审查:审查合约调用的第三方库与外部合约,关注delegatecall、外部预言机和可升级代理的风险。

- 自动化监测:将目标合约纳入监控清单,订阅事件(如Transfer、Approval、OwnershipTransferred)与异常行为告警。

四、专家观点报告(样式与关键结论)

- 风险评级:基于上述巡检与合约审核,给出高/中/低三档评级并注明评判依据(如多签阈值、合约可升级性、私钥治理成熟度)。

- 建议清单:短期(立即执行)与中长期(治理与技术改进)建议,如调整多签阈值、引入第三方审计、上线持续漏洞赏金计划。

- 业务影响分析:对关键风险事件(如助记词泄露、合约管理员滥用)进行量化场景分析与损失评估,提供应对成本估算。

- 合规与披露:建议按监管或行业自律要求,对重要密钥治理与重大变更进行透明披露与合规记录。

五、公钥(公钥管理与技术细节)

- 公钥与地址管理:保存可导出的公钥(xpub/公钥)用于离线生成或在托管系统中产生地址(watch-only),避免在联机设备暴露私钥。

- 验证与备份:公钥应与私钥生成时的随机源绑定并多点备份,使用签名证明公钥归属(离线签名一句话并在联机端验证)。

- 格式与兼容性:注意不同链的公钥/地址编码格式(例如以太坊、BTC、EVM兼容链差异),并记录派生路径(BIP32/44/49/84)。

- 公钥轮换策略:对可能长期使用的公钥设计轮换与退役流程,避免单一长期公钥成为攻击集中点。

六、自动化管理(提高运维效率与安全性)

- Watch-only 与自动化监控:在联机平台或运维仪表盘导入xpub做余额与交易监控,结合阈值告警(大额转账、异常频次)。

- 多签与阈值签名集成:引入Gnosis Safe等多签工具或阈值签名(MPC)方案,将单点私钥替换为分布式签名机制,提升可用性与抗攻击能力。

- 签名流程自动化:将签名请求、审批流程上链或进入企业内部审批流(含多步审批与时间延迟),通过自动化脚本生成交易模板并发送至冷签设备或MPC签名节点。

- HSM与密钥管理系统:对高价值托管,考虑使用硬件安全模块(HSM)或商业MPC服务,结合证书与密钥生命周期管理(KMS)。

- 恶意行为检测与回溯:自动化保留所有交易签名材料的哈希与时间戳,用于事后取证与责任溯源(注意不要保存敏感私钥材料)。

七、未来技术与创新前景

- 多方计算(MPC)与阈值签名:MPC能够在不集中私钥的前提下实现安全签名,降低单点失陷风险,未来将进一步普及企业级托管。

- 安全执行环境(TEE/SGX)与链下可信硬件:结合TEE的签名模块可以在受限环境中隔离私钥操作,但需对固件漏洞保持警惕。

- 零信任与可验证计算:通过可验证签名流程与链下证明(zk-proof)来增强交易可审计性与不可否认性。

- 空气隔离与QR签名生态:改进的离线签名与跨设备QR交互协议将使冷钱包签名更便利且更易被非技术用户采用。

结论:构建TP冷钱包并非一次性工作,而是结合技术、流程、治理与监控的持续工程。关键在于标准化的安全巡检、严格的合约验证、明确的备份与应急流程、以及将自动化与新兴加密技术(多签/MPC/HSM)纳入长期规划。任何单一环节的失败都可能导致资产风险,故建议在部署前进行完整的演练与第三方审计,并把专家报告作为决策依据。

作者:李思远发布时间:2025-10-13 12:33:37

评论

CryptoLi

很实用的落地清单,特别赞同定期恢复演练这一点。

张明

合约验证部分讲得很细,能否再给出常用开源工具列表?

Alice_W

关于MPC的展望写得很到位,期待更多企业级案例分享。

安全小王子

建议在物理安全那节增加对运输与保管链的具体建议,比如双人签收。

吴清

文章结构清晰,适合项目方作为实施手册的骨架。

相关阅读